Katie & Matt had a very personal and private wedding with on 25 of their closest friends and family at The Moat House in Staffordshire. It was a right old party full of music, booze (of course) and lots and lots of dancing! Katie looked quite the Rock n Roll princess in her Ian Stuart ‘Mae’ dress and her Benjamin Roberts shoes. Matt looked just as stylish in his suit by Reiss. What made this wedding even better and more personal was that a friend of the family did the flowers and Katie’s sister’s best friend made the cake.
